Understanding osteoporosis
Osteoporosis is a condition in which bones become fragile and porous, significantly increasing the risk of fractures from even minor injuries. Bones are living tissues, continuously renewing through two main processes:
resorption and
remodeling. Up until the age of 35-40, these processes are balanced. However, with advancing age, particularly during menopause, bone resorption outpaces remodeling, leading to a gradual loss of bone density. This imbalance, strongly influenced by declining estrogen levels, creates the perfect environment for osteoporosis to develop.
What happens during menopause?
The onset of menopause involves extensive physical, hormonal, and emotional transformations. As the ovaries cease the production of estrogen and progesterone, women often experience physical symptoms such as hot flashes, night sweats,
insomnia, and weight gain. Emotionally, menopause may trigger anxiety, mood swings, and mild depression. However, the silent yet serious impact of estrogen loss is on bone health, significantly increasing the risk of developing osteoporosis.
The impact of estrogen decline on bone health
Estrogen plays a critical role in maintaining bone density by regulating calcium absorption in both the intestines and kidneys and promoting the conversion of Vitamin D into its active form. When estrogen levels drop during menopause, the body’s capacity to absorb calcium diminishes, making it difficult for bones to retain essential minerals. Additionally, estrogen directly regulates the activity of
osteoclasts—cells that break down bone tissue. The reduction in estrogen stimulates increased osteoclast activity, accelerating bone density loss and heightening fracture risk.
